removing winko,auto.exe

my computer,running on windows xp has been infected by the auto.exe virus.autorun.inf and winko.the winko virus.in safe mode, i was able to delete all but the winko virus which was in the inaccessible (in the system volume information folder ).when i revert to normal mode, the viruses are stiLl there.please advise!!!!!

Click start>click run type in msconfig and then press enter. Goto the start up tab and uncheck everything except your anti virus,click ok and reboot.

Run
Security News from the net: Malwarebytes Anti-Malware

Run a complete scan with free curing utility
Dr.Web CureIt! – download free anti-virus! Cure viruses, Best free anti-virus scanner!
